DNF-BUILDDEP - Online Linux Manual PageSection : 8
Updated : Apr 05, 2023
Source : 4.4.0
Note : dnf-plugins-core

NAMEdnf-builddep − DNF builddep Plugin Install whatever is needed to build the given .src.rpm, .nosrc.rpm or .spec file. WARNING: Build dependencies in a package (i.e. src.rpm) might be different than you would expect because they were evaluated according macros set on the package build host.

SYNOPSISdnf builddep <package>...

ARGUMENTS <package>  Either path to .src.rpm, .nosrc.rpm or .spec file or package available in a repository.

OPTIONSAll general DNF options are accepted, see Options in dnf(8) for details. −−help−cmd  Show this help. −D <macro expr>, −−define <macro expr>  Define the RPM macro named macro to the value expr when parsing spec files. Does not apply for source rpm files. −−spec  Treat arguments as .spec files. −−srpm  Treat arguments as source rpm files. −−skip−unavailable  Skip build dependencies not available in repositories. All available build dependencies will be installed. Note that builddep command does not honor the −−skip−broken option, so there is no way to skip uninstallable packages (e.g. with broken dependencies).

EXAMPLES dnf builddep foobar.spec  Install the needed build requirements, defined in the foobar.spec file. dnf builddep −−spec foobar.spec.in  Install the needed build requirements, defined in the spec file when filename ends with something different than ​.spec​. dnf builddep foobar−1.0−1.src.rpm  Install the needed build requirements, defined in the foobar−1.0−1.src.rpm file. dnf builddep foobar−1.0−1  Look up foobar−1.0−1 in enabled repositories and install build requirements for its source rpm. dnf builddep −D 'scl python27' python−foobar.spec  Install the needed build requirements for the python27 SCL version of python−foobar.

AUTHORSee AUTHORS in your Core DNF Plugins distribution

COPYRIGHT2023, Red Hat, Licensed under GPLv2+
0
Johanes Gumabo
Data Size   :   10,028 byte
man-dnf-builddep.8Build   :   2024-12-05, 20:55   :  
Visitor Screen   :   x
Visitor Counter ( page / site )   :   3 / 184,626
Visitor ID   :     :  
Visitor IP   :   18.191.171.86   :  
Visitor Provider   :   AMAZON-02   :  
Provider Position ( lat x lon )   :   39.962500 x -83.006100   :   x
Provider Accuracy Radius ( km )   :   1000   :  
Provider City   :   Columbus   :  
Provider Province   :   Ohio ,   :   ,
Provider Country   :   United States   :  
Provider Continent   :   North America   :  
Visitor Recorder   :   Version   :  
Visitor Recorder   :   Library   :  
Online Linux Manual Page   :   Version   :   Online Linux Manual Page - Fedora.40 - march=x86-64 - mtune=generic - 24.12.05
Online Linux Manual Page   :   Library   :   lib_c - 24.10.03 - march=x86-64 - mtune=generic - Fedora.40
Online Linux Manual Page   :   Library   :   lib_m - 24.10.03 - march=x86-64 - mtune=generic - Fedora.40
Data Base   :   Version   :   Online Linux Manual Page Database - 24.04.13 - march=x86-64 - mtune=generic - fedora-38
Data Base   :   Library   :   lib_c - 23.02.07 - march=x86-64 - mtune=generic - fedora.36

Very long time ago, I have the best tutor, Wenzel Svojanovsky . If someone knows the email address of Wenzel Svojanovsky , please send an email to johanes_gumabo@yahoo.co.id .
If error, please print screen and send to johanes_gumabo@yahoo.co.id
Under development. Support me via PayPal.